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
732169996 0199313 1941346809
80725295 3987
80725295 3987
9943 12204073 82753936971 50093527
All about undefined
Interested in learning more?
80725295 3987
9943 12204073 82753936971 50093527
See more
29570670018 504126
986637 793458 5481249
See more
9943307 5830036
27331 27985 5813924918 352
See more